How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Miami Beach?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Miami Beach Studio Apartments | $2,397 | $1,150 | $5,880 |
Miami Beach 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,065 | $1,277 | $7,800 |
Miami Beach 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,153 | $1,333 | $10,000+ |
Miami Beach 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,105 | $2,600 | $10,000+ |
Miami Beach 4 Bedroom Apartments | $20,479 | $3,650 | $10,000+ |

Miami Beach Studio Apartment Units with Current Availability by Neighborhood
Availability Confirmed As of: April 13, 2025There are currently 264 available Studio apartment units from neighborhoods all over Miami Beach, FL that range in price from $1,350 to $4,592. South Beach, Flamingo and Lummus Park are the neighborhoods that currently have the most Studio availability. Here is today's list of the top neighborhoods in Miami Beach with the most available Studio apartments:
Neighborhood | Available Units | Median Price | Min Price |
---|---|---|---|
South Beach | 81 | $2,333 | $1,600 |
Flamingo | 62 | $1,998 | $1,600 |
Lummus Park | 31 | $2,385 | $1,715 |
Mid Beach | 31 | $2,385 | $1,500 |
North Beach | 31 | $1,700 | $1,350 |
Miami Beach Boardwalk | 28 | $2,385 | $1,700 |

Miami Beach Overview
Arguably one of the nation's most revered beachfront regions, Miami Beach is practically the epitome of Florida living. Boasting scenic, sun-drenched shores, retail shopping galore, and plenty of job opportunities, this consistent hot spot is an in-demand locale with good reason.
Why live in Miami Beach, FL?
Long considered a southern paradise, Miami Beach rentals offer some of the best that Florida has to offer. Gorgeous seaside views meld with an array of local shopping, dining and nightlife amenities, while the city's close proximity to Miami proper grants residents an easy commute to one of the largest and most consistent local economies in the entire Sunshine State.
